Viewing an S Multi-Shot or M Multi-Shot Still Image in Enlarged Display Mode While still images (16 frames in a file) taken by SCONT or MCONT are displayed, one of the 16 frames can be displayed in an enlarged view. While viewing an enlarged frame image, you can switch between frames. To view a shot from S Multi-Shot or M Multi-Shot still images in Enlarged Display Mode, follow the steps below. 1. Press the 6 (Playback) button. The last shot taken is displayed. 2. Press the #$ buttons to display an S Multi-Shot or M Multi-Shot still image. 3. Press the 8 (Enlarged Display) button. The first frame of consecutive images is displayed in Enlarged Display Mode. The shot position bar appears at the lower part of the LCD monitor. Press the #$ buttons to feed the shot. To return to the 16-shot display, press the M/O button. Note Press the DISP. button to turn on or off the bar display at the lower part of the LCD moitor.
